Posted:1 week ago|
Platform:
Work from Office
Full Time
Overview We are seeking a Senior Software Engineer with expertise in Java, Microservices architecture, API development, and database technologies (Oracle/PostgreSQL) to design, develop, and manage robust database-driven applications. This role involves working with Java-based frameworks , cloud environments, and database technologies to deliver scalable, secure, and high-performance solutions. The ideal candidate will have extensive experience in full-stack development , strong problem-solving skills, and a proven ability to lead complex projects. Application Development: Design, develop, and maintain applications leveraging Java, Spring Boot , and Microservices architecture . Experience with Spring Framework (e.g., Spring Boot, Spring Security, Spring Data, Spring Cloud) . Build and optimize RESTful APIs for seamless integration between services. Develop and implement database schemas (Oracle & PostgreSQL), ensuring data integrity and performance optimization . Proficiency in multithreading, concurrency, and JVM internals . Familiarity with securing Java applications using OAuth, JWT, SSL/TLS, and other security protocols. System Design & Integration: Collaborate with application architects and business analysts to design and integrate Java-based solutions with databases and external systems. Ensure seamless integration between Oracle/PostgreSQL databases and front-end/middleware applications. Testing & Documentation: Develop and execute unit tests, integration tests, and performance tests for Java-based applications. Maintain comprehensive documentation for application designs, database schemas, and system workflows . Technical Expertise: Proficiency in Java and Spring Boot framework . Strong understanding of Microservices architecture and RESTful API development . Experience with Oracle and PostgreSQL databases , including SQL tuning and optimization. Familiarity with containerization technologies (Docker, Kubernetes). Development Practices: Hands-on experience with Agile development methodologies . Familiarity with version control systems (Git, SVN) and CI/CD pipelines . Strong grasp of software development lifecycle (SDLC) and DevOps practices . Good to Have: Knowledge of message queues (Kafka, RabbitMQ). Experience working with cloud platforms (AWS, Azure, or Google Cloud). Understanding of middleware technologies and APIs for database interaction. Preferred Qualifications: Bachelor s or Master s degree in Computer Science or related field. Exposure to DevOps practices and tools. Experience working in Agile/Scrum environments
Accelya
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
My Connections Accelya
12.0 - 13.0 Lacs P.A.
3.0 - 7.0 Lacs P.A.
Pune/Pimpri-Chinchwad Area
Salary: Not disclosed
Pune/Pimpri-Chinchwad Area
Salary: Not disclosed
11.0 - 12.0 Lacs P.A.
11.0 - 12.0 Lacs P.A.
11.0 - 12.0 Lacs P.A.
9.0 - 18.0 Lacs P.A.
Coimbatore
3.0 - 8.0 Lacs P.A.
Ahmedabad
5.0 - 9.0 Lacs P.A.